Yes, this is a comon problem with diesel tanks especially ones that store and are infrequently in use. Marine applications are notorious for this problem but all tanks should be inspected and, if a problem discovered, properly treated with an anti-fungicide/bacterial product.

   / Bugs in my gas? #5  
These are Micro-organisms that multiple but not actual 'bugs' although under a microscope you may see what apears to be bugs.
